Bürkle GmbH has introduced the SiloDrill, a robust sampling tool designed to collect representative all-layer samples from bulk solids stored in tanks and silos. As bulk materials often segregate during transport and storage, consistent sampling through all layers is essential for accurate quality, composition, and property analysis. Caminhos do Futuro, the last remaining olive oil mill in Montemor-o-Novo, Portugal, has significantly boosted its processing capacity with the installation of Alfa Laval’s advanced Foodec Sigma decanter. The upgrade has enabled the cooperative to quadruple its output from 1,500 kg/hour to 6,000 kg/hour, supporting a growing network of local farmers while preserving a long-standing agricultural…
